Mosta assert dominance over Marsaxlokk

MARSAXLOKK 1

Fonesca 43

MOSTA 4

Ememe 14, 35, 87pen; Failla 40pen

MARSAXLOKK F. Tabone-4, T. Tabone Desira-5 (72 A. Effiong), Jeferson-4 ( 46 F. Moracci), C. Borg-5 (46 A. Attard-), W. Serrano-4, E. Vella-4, A. Ferraris Santiago-, O. Carniello-5, Wellignton-4, D. Agius-4 (83 D. Mifsud), T. Fonesca-5.

MOSTA I. Apkan-6, T. Akiti-5.5 (46 Z.Brincat-6), P. Mensah-6, C. Ememe-8, C. Failla-6.5 (82 D. Bonnici), G. Sciberras-6 (59 N. Agius), M. Okoh-5 (68 L. Tenebe), C. Akrong- 6, G. Acheampong-6.5( 82 T. Farrugia), J. Vassallo-7, R. Ekani-6.5

Referee Andrea Sciriha

Yellow cards Ekani, Acheampong, Jeferson, Ferraris, Brincat, Tabone

Red card Adrian Ferraris (Marsaxlokk) 80

BOV Player of the Match Christ Ememe (Mosta).

Christ Ememe scored a hat-trick to give Mosta their first win of the season and hand Marsaxlokk a reality check on their return to the Premier league.

Marsaxlokk had been away from the Premier League for 13 years and it showed as they made a laboured start.

Christ Ememe immediately scored his first goal for Mosta since returning from his long lay-off, after latching on to a throughball. Marsaxlokk goalkeeper Fredrick Tabone tried to push the striker wide, but Ememe eventually shot into the bottom corner.

Perhaps unsurprising, given the number of new personnel on their side – seven making their debut – Marsaxlokk looked disjointed.

And Mosta poured forward. On 35 minutes, Clayton Failla swung in a cross from the left and Ememe found the corner of the net with a cleanly-struck shot.

Nothing was going Marsaxlokk’s way. Five minutes later, Jeferson brought down Gianluca Sciberras on the edge of the box, prompting referee Andrea Sciriha to whistle a penalty. From the ensuing spot kick, Failla drove his shot past Tabone.

Marsaxlokk’s first-half display did not merit a goal, but they found the net when Adan Tiago Fonesca hit a low shot past Ini Akpan two minutes before the break.

Heads had to go down in the interval in the Marsaxlokk camp and eventually, coach Pablo Doffo made a double substitution, bringing on Fabian Moracci and Ayrton Attard for Jeferson and Conor Borg respectively.

Still, Mosta came forward with substitute Linus Tenebe squaring the ball for Ememe who hit the foot of the post.

Ten minutes from time, Adrian Ferraris was sent off for a second bookable offence and as Marsaxlokk tried to re-organise to combat the loss of their midfielder, Zachary Brincat left the crossbar shaking with an effort which bounced off the bar.

And three minutes from the end, with Marsaxlokk completely in disarray, goalkeeper Tabone was penalised for hauling Brincat down in the box.  From the resulting penalty, Ememe completed his hat-trick by firing home an angled drive to underline Mosta’s superiority.
